The Mechanics Of Supernovas
So, what exactly is a supernova? In simple terms, a supernova is an incredibly powerful explosion that occurs when a star runs out of fuel and collapses under its own gravity.
This collapse creates an enormous amount of energy, which is then released in the form of light and heat, creating the spectacular display we see from Earth.
The Science Behind Supernovas
Supernovas are classified into two main types: Type I and Type II. Type I supernovas are thought to occur when a white dwarf star accumulates material from a companion star, while Type II supernovas result from the collapse of a massive star.
Understanding the mechanics of supernovas is crucial for astronomers, as it can provide valuable insights into the universe's evolution and the life cycle of stars.
